CHILDFUND AUSTRALIA

ChildFund Australia is an independent international development organisation that works to reduce poverty for children in many of the world’s most disadvantaged communities.

ChildFund Australia works with partners to create community and systems change which enables vulnerable children and young people, in all their diversity, to assert and realise their rights.

PLAN INTERNATIONAL AUSTRALIA

PLAN International is an independent development and humanitarian organisation that advances children’s rights and equality for girls, and strives for a just world, working together with children, young people, supporters, and partners.

YOUNG & RESILIENT RESEARCH CENTRE

The Young and Resilient Research Centre is an Australian-based, international research centre that unites young people with researchers, practitioners, innovators, and policymakers to explore the role of technology in children’s and young people’s lives and how it can be used to improve individual and community resilience across generations.
